Cold Weather Tip: Warm up Indoors
by Jenny Sugar 1
I don't know about you but working out in the cold can sometimes be uncomfortable because it makes my muscles extra tight. What helps me is to warm up inside before heading out into the chilly weather.
Before a run or bike ride, I do about 5-10 minutes of light cardio inside. Jogging in place, jumping rope, or going up and down my stairs is just enough activity to loosen up my body and get my blood pumping. When I get outside, it's less of a shock to my system. If you'd rather do your warm-up exercises outside, a hot shower is another great way to loosen up your muscles before a cold weather workout.
